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
167253225 350304931 64461019277
92461 9920839411
92461 9920839411
88168644234 85096559349 519081
All about undefined
Interested in learning more?
92461 9920839411
88168644234 85096559349 519081
See more
996 1127412
0322 548 51353992056 06
See more
2032375294 940094475
6876121 7378585942 8532412887
See more